Changed defaults in Splitfork, our assignment service. Bucketing now uses sticky hashing per account instead of per session, and the holdout slice grew from 2% to 5%. Callers relying on session-level reassignment must opt in explicitly. Review the diff against the new baseline; the updated default configuration is listed below.

config for tagep-kajof:
[casir]
port = 6379
region = south-1
host = casir.paliqdyn.example
team = tamax
timeout_ms = 250
retries = 2

FAQ: Consent banner rollout (Project Lanternfold). Q: What's live? A: Banner v3 is at 50% in the Veldoria region; full rollout Friday. Q: Who owns it? A: The Brightmere privacy squad. Q: What if the banner breaks checkout? A: Kill switch is in the Opsheld console, flag cb_v3_enabled. Q: What if the console itself is locked? A: Use the emergency override, which requires the recovery passphrase printed directly below this entry.

strongbox words: sorir-belvan-rusix-ulays-ralmir-praix-eliir-tamax-praael-druael-julir-tamius-jorir

Ticket: TXT-uploads on Marblevale staging are all coming back as "unknown encoding." Looks like the Glyphsniff detection service got redeployed without its auth setting, so every request to it 401s and we fall back to the dumb ASCII guesser. Fun. On-call: grab the staging .env on the glyph worker box and fix it. Right after the GLYPHSNIFF_URL line, add the following.

vault entry, kawep-yahof: LEDGER_TOKEN29=aed31a7c3a275025cbea1ab2c10a7